Forward Industries revenue from 2010 to 2025. Revenue can be defined as the amount of money a company receives from its customers in exchange for the sales of goods or services. Revenue is the top line item on an income statement from which all costs and expenses are subtracted to arrive at net income.

FORWARD INDUSTRIES, INC. is engaged in the business of designing, manufacturing and selling of custom soft-sided carrying cases and advertising specialties.
